Medical Expenses and Future Care
One of the most significant areas of compensation after a truck collision involves medical costs. Victims can recover money for hospital visits, surgeries, medications, physical therapy, and any other treatment related to their injuries. Serious injuries often require long-term care or rehabilitation, and those future costs should also be included in the claim. Some victims may never fully recover and could need lifelong medical support. Having proper documentation of all medical expenses is essential for building a strong case. These damages are meant to relieve financial pressure so victims can focus on healing.
Lost Wages and Reduced Earning Capacity
After a truck accident, many people are unable to return to work for a while. Compensation can cover lost income during the recovery period. Severe injuries can prevent someone from returning to their old job or performing the work they once did. If that happens, the claim can include lost future earnings or reduced earning capacity. This helps protect the financial stability of the victim and their family. The goal is to ensure that the injury does not lead to long-term financial hardship.
Property Damage and Vehicle Replacement
Truck collisions often cause major property damage. Passenger vehicles can be completely destroyed in an impact with a large commercial truck. Compensation for property damage can be paid to repair or replace a vehicle and belongings damaged in the crash. This may also include the cost of rental cars or transportation while repairs are made. The purpose of this compensation is to restore the victim to the position they were in before the accident. While vehicles can be replaced, it is important that victims are not left to shoulder those expenses alone.
Pain and Suffering
Not all losses after a truck accident are financial. Victims may experience significant physical pain and emotional suffering. This type of compensation supports emotional recovery after an accident, including feelings of fear, sadness, and loss of joy. Pain and suffering damages are more difficult to calculate because they do not have a fixed dollar value. However, they play an important role in providing full justice for the harm caused. Punitive Damages in Severe Cases
Sometimes the court may decide to grant punitive damages. These are not meant to compensate the victim but to punish the responsible party for reckless or intentional behavior. For example, if a trucking company fails to follow safety rules or hires a driver who has not received proper training, the court may award additional damages. These damages send a clear message that such conduct will not be tolerated. While they are less common, they can significantly increase the total compensation in a serious case.
